All in all, this book wasn’t too boring but I didn’t love it. It was very repetitive.
——
Along with this, the big reveal about Prentisstown’s past was a bit underwhelming, but I liked how since Todd doesn’t know how to read properly he spells some words wrong like “shun” instead of “tion”.
I will continue reading the series, hopefully it gets better.
